Joanandjoe Posted August 10, 2004 #1 Share Posted August 10, 2004 We couldn't resist the headline. Seriously, we sail from Nice on Sunday. 11/7, and would like to arrive one or two days early. The hotel used by Windstar (Le Meridien) is priced ludicrously for November: $170 per person for the first night, with transfers. I think we could do better to pay the $75 "air deviation" fee and book our own hotels. Even 120 Euros per night, with breakfast, would be an improvement. That probably means a 3 star or very nice two star hotel. Any suggestions? The Comfort Hotel Roosevelt is very cheap, but only two stars. The three Citadines look interesting (especially Fleurs and Promenade), and we could make our own salade Niceoise in our kitchenette; but they also seem a bit far from the pier. The Windsor and Gounod also sound good; but this is based solely on recommendations from Frommers. What we'd like are your recommendations. kate52 Posted August 13, 2004 #3 Share Posted August 13, 2004 We stayed at the 4 star Hotel Massena a few years back. It's in a very good position, a few doors down from Galleries Laffayette, and convenient for old town, promenade, and pedestrianised shopping area. Octopus are quoting it at $136 per room per night.
